🏗️ Structural Modeling and Design (Partie 2 & 3):

The course is divided into two practical parts, where you will apply your knowledge:

  1. Design and Dimensionnement of Reinforced Concrete Structures according to ACI 318 and UBC 97 for Seismic Analysis:

    • Learn to model concrete structures, analyze them for seismic resistance, and dimension them in accordance with the American Concrete Institute (ACI) 318 code.
    • Understand and apply the Uniform Building Code (UBC) 97 for seismic analysis.
  2. Design and Dimensionnement of Steel Structures according to Eurocodes:

    • Master the modeling and dimensioning of steel structures in compliance with European standards (Eurocodes).

Our review

Course Review Synthesis

Overall Rating: 4.63

Pros:

  • Clear and Detailed Explanations: The course provides comprehensive explanations with clear manipulations, making it easy to understand, as noted by multiple reviewers.
  • RDM Explanations: The inclusion of Resistance des Matériaux (RDM) alongside the main content is highly appreciated and adds significant value for students.
  • Pedagogical Approach: The instructor's pedagogical skills are highlighted, with special mention of how the course content is conveyed in a way that inspires a desire to master ROBOT Structural Analysis.
  • Quality of Instruction: The expertise and qualification of the course author and educator have been commended by several learners.
  • Comprehensive Coverage: The course offers solid foundations for beginners and covers various codes (like Eurocodes or ACI), which is crucial for practical application.
  • Real-World Applications: Learners appreciate the real-world examples and details given, which are considered useful for their professional development.
  • Highly Recommended: The course has been described as "exceptionnel" and "highly recommended," indicating its value in the field of structural analysis.

Cons:

  • Missing Modules: Some learners have pointed out the absence of certain modules, such as the dimensioning of redressement longrines, staircases, and more detailed parameters for metallic elements.
  • Desire for More Practical Examples: A few reviewers have expressed a desire for additional practical examples to complement the theoretical content.
  • More In-Depth Parametrics: There is a need for more in-depth explanations on certain aspects, particularly regarding the parametrics of barres and their crucial role in dimensioning.
